
Shine On, Marquee Moon by Zoë Howe
Shine On, Marquee Moon is a romantic satire of the music industry from a female point of view, celebrating the extremes and challenging the myth of sex, drugs and rock 'n' roll with plenty of humour, technicolour characters and sharp dialogue along the way.
Zoë Howe is an acclaimed British music writer whose books include Lee Brilleaux: Rock ’n’ Roll Gentleman (Polygon, 2015), Barbed Wire Kisses -–The Jesus and Mary Chain Story (Polygon, 2015), Wilko Johnson – Looking Back At Me (Cadiz Music Ltd., 2012), Stevie Nicks - Visions, Dreams and Rumours (Omnibus Press, 2014) and Typical Girls? The Story Of The Slits (Omnibus Press, 2011). She also plays the drums.
